The Birth Of M&ms

M&Ms were born during World War II. Soldiers needed chocolate that wouldn’t melt. Forrest Mars Sr. saw a solution. He partnered with Bruce Murrie. They created a candy with a hard shell. M&Ms were an instant hit with the troops. Today, they are loved worldwide.

Mars Family’s Confectionery Beginnings

The Mars family started their journey in the early 1900s. Frank C. Mars began making chocolates in his kitchen. His son, Forrest Mars Sr., joined him. They launched the Milky Way bar in 1923. It was a big success. This success paved the way for more products.

Snickers: Crafting The Perfect Chocolate Bar

Snickers is a blend of chocolate, peanuts, caramel, and nougat. This combination creates a rich and satisfying taste. Each ingredient plays a key role.

  • Chocolate: The outer layer is smooth and creamy.
  • Peanuts: Adds crunch and a salty balance.
  • Caramel: Offers a chewy and sweet texture.
  • Nougat: Provides a soft and fluffy base.

Snickers is not just a snack; it’s a meal in a bar. It delivers energy and satisfies hunger. This makes Snickers perfect for people on the go.

Twix: The Caramel Revolution

Twix is famous for its unique structure. It has a crunchy biscuit, caramel, and chocolate. Each bite is a mix of textures.

  1. Biscuit: The base is crunchy and light.
  2. Caramel: The layer adds sweetness and chewiness.
  3. Chocolate: It wraps everything in a creamy finish.

Twix stands out because of its dual-bar format, which allows sharing or saving one for later. The combination of biscuit and caramel is revolutionary, offering a balanced taste experience.

Successful Campaigns And Sponsorships

Mars brands have led many successful marketing campaigns. M&M is known for its colourful characters, which appear in many TV ads and online videos. These characters make the brand fun and memorable.

Snickers has a famous tagline: “You’re not you when you’re hungry.” This campaign shows people acting silly, eating Snickers, and returning to normal, making Snickers popular.

Twix uses the “Left Twix vs. Right Twix” campaign. This fun rivalry makes people choose sides and keeps the brand in people’s minds.

Mars also sponsors significant events. They have sponsored sports events like the Super Bowl. They also sponsor pet shows for Pedigree and Whiskas. This makes their brands more visible and trusted.
